Ralf Köpsel is a scholar working on Biomedical Engineering, Materials Chemistry and Mechanical Engineering. According to data from OpenAlex, Ralf Köpsel has authored 12 papers receiving a total of 451 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Biomedical Engineering, 5 papers in Materials Chemistry and 4 papers in Mechanical Engineering. Recurrent topics in Ralf Köpsel's work include Thermochemical Biomass Conversion Processes (6 papers), Thermal and Kinetic Analysis (3 papers) and Advanced Combustion Engine Technologies (3 papers). Ralf Köpsel is often cited by papers focused on Thermochemical Biomass Conversion Processes (6 papers), Thermal and Kinetic Analysis (3 papers) and Advanced Combustion Engine Technologies (3 papers). Ralf Köpsel collaborates with scholars based in Germany and Poland. Ralf Köpsel's co-authors include Judith Friebel, P. Streubel, R. Hesse, Thomas de Lange, Κ. Wiesener, K. Schwabe, M Beer and Dieter Naumann and has published in prestigious journals such as Carbon, Electrochimica Acta and Fuel.
